Gospić and Koprivnica Pay Tribute to Veterans on 31st Anniversary of Operation Storm

The ceremonial program in Gospić includes a commemoration, Mass, and concert, while wreaths have already been laid and candles lit in Koprivnica for all fallen defenders.

Croatia is marking Victory and Homeland Thanksgiving Day, Croatian Veterans Day, and 31 years since the military-police operation "Storm." The main celebrations are scheduled for August 5, 2026, in Gospić, but tributes to the fallen are already being paid in other parts of the country. In Koprivnica, wreaths and candles were laid on Monday, August 3.

Full-Day Program in Gospić

The Lika-Senj County, in partnership with the Ministry of Croatian Veterans, the City of Gospić, and the Coordination of Associations from the Homeland War, has prepared a detailed schedule for August 5. Veterans will gather at 8:00 AM at Zrinski and Frankopan Square, from where they will depart for Ljubovo at 8:30 AM.

At Ljubovo, a commemoration is scheduled for 9:30 AM at the "Victor" monument. Upon returning to Gospić, wreaths will be laid and candles lit at noon at the Monument to Croatian Veterans and Civilian Victims of the Homeland War, as well as in front of the bust of Dr. Franjo Tuđman at Alojzije Stepinac Square. This will be followed by a Mass for the Homeland at the Cathedral of the Annunciation of the Blessed Virgin Mary at 12:30 PM.

For citizens, from 2:00 PM in Kolakovac Park, there will be food distribution and entertainment for all ages. The ceremony concludes with a concert by the band Vigor at Stjepan Radić Square at 9:00 PM, as reported by GS Press Lika.

Koprivnica Already Pays Tribute

In Koprivnica, wreaths have already been laid and candles lit at the Monument to Croatian Freedom. Tributes were paid by delegations from the Koprivnica-Križevci County and the City of Koprivnica, representatives of the Ministry of Defense and the Ministry of the Interior, the Regional Unit of the Ministry of Croatian Veterans, associations from the Homeland War, as well as families of fallen veterans.

After the official part, a requiem Mass was held at the Parish Church of St. Nicholas the Bishop for all fallen, missing, and deceased Croatian veterans, as reported by Podravski list.
